NodeJs

Giải mã Child Processes trong NodeJs

🧠 Giải mã Child Process trong Node.js – Khi nào cần “tách não” cho ứng dụng.
Node.js mạnh ở I/O, nhưng với các tác vụ nặng CPU, chạy command hệ thống, hay xử lý song song, single-thread có thể trở thành điểm nghẽn. Lúc này, child process chính là vũ khí bạn cần.
Trong video này, chúng ta sẽ cùng giải mã child process trong Node.js từ gốc rễ:
🔹 Child process là gì? Giải quyết vấn đề gì trong Node.js
🔹 Event Loop và mối liên hệ với child process
🔹 Phân biệt exec, spawn, fork – dùng sai là toang 😅
🔹 Khi nào nên dùng child process thay vì worker_threads
🔹 Demo thực tế: chạy command hệ thống & xử lý tác vụ nặng
🔹 Quản lý process, giao tiếp IPC giữa parent – child
🔹 Những lỗi phổ biến: memory leak, zombie process, block hệ thống
🎯 Sau video này, bạn sẽ:
 • Hiểu rõ bản chất child process trong Node.js
 • Biết cách chọn đúng API cho từng bài toán
 • Xây dựng ứng dụng Node.js ổn định và scalable hơn